Quality Care and Maintenance
Proper maintenance extends product lifespan and maintains peak performance throughout extended use. Hand washing with mild soap and cool water prevents damage to sensitive materials. Air drying in shade away from direct sunlight protects elastic integrity and fabric quality. Following manufacturer care guidelines ensures your equipment maintains optimal performance throughout its service life.
